INTER-SCHOOL TENNIS

TAHORA DEFEATS RAEKOHUA. ' A return tennis match between the Raekohua and Tahora schools was played on the Tahora club courts last Saturday. Tahora avenged its previous defeat by winning 11 sets, 80 games to 4 sets, 44 games. Details, Tahora names first, are:— Boys’ si’-igles: B. Cadman beat M. Hart 6—l, R. John beat P. Northcott 6—l, R. Selby beat S. Taylor 6—3, K. McCartie beat M. Moore 6—o. Girls’ singles: Millie Slade lost to Una Betts 2—6, Jean Grant beat Maggie Walsh 6—5, Mona Lowe lost to B. Savage 4—6. Boys’ doubles: Cadman and Selby beat

Hart and Northcott 6—l, Johns and McCartie beat Taylor and Moore 6—o.

Girls’ doubles: M. Slade and J. Grant beat A. Betts and M. Walsh 6-4, J. Grant and M. Lowe lost. to M. Northcott and B. Savage 4—6. Combined doubles: Cadman and Millie Slade beat Hart and Una Betts 6—2, Johns and Jean Grant beat Northcott and Molly Walsh 6—3, Selby and Mona Lowe lost to Taylor and Betty Savage 4—6, McCartie and Jean Grant beat Moore and Betty Savage 6—o.
